I have a tempur-pedic. I don't like it during the warmer months unless I have my A/C set below 75 because it can get pretty warm sleeping on one due to the mold-like formation caused by your body weight.

I do find it very comfortable when it is not too warm.

I imagine Steve's already found his mattress, but I'll add another vote for Cantwell Mattress over off McCollough. I've been buying from them since the 80s and they are the best quality I've found. The fact they build to order really sweetens the deal, since what I was looking for I wasn't finding in other mattresses.

I purchased one for my grandfather when I was taking care of him. He weighed 212lbs and sat in the edge of the bed for extended periods of time, exactly what distorts most beds and they warn against. When he passed, I put it in my guest room and people comment on how comfortable it is. The one I sleep on is over 10 years old without any detectable depression on it.

I've got a friend who purchased a memory foam bed. He hates it in the summer, and mentioned it's a bit unwieldy for amorous encounters
